  • Sage Geosystems

    Participated · Series B · Jan 2026

    Sage Geosystems is a Houston-based pressure geothermal company that extracts energy from hot dry rock by harnessing both the earth’s heat and natural pressure. Its proprietary system supports three main applications: grid-scale energy storage, 24/7 power generation, and direct heating, which together broaden geothermal’s viable geography beyond traditional hydrothermal regions. The firm is currently building its first commercial pressure-geothermal power facility within an existing Ormat power plant, showcasing a pathway to low-cost, baseload renewable electricity. In 2024 Sage signed an agreement with Meta to supply up to 150 MW of geothermal baseload power for data-center expansion east of the Rocky Mountains. Proceeds from the latest financing will fund continued technology development, construction of the inaugural commercial plant, and expansion of its energy-storage offering. Following its Series B, the company has raised more than $97 million to date, backed by a mix of strategic energy players and climate-focused investors. Although Sage has not disclosed revenue or user metrics, the size of this round underscores investor confidence in its ability to scale geothermal as a global clean-energy resource.

  • Origen

    Participated · Series A · Jan 2025

    Origen develops a limestone-based direct air capture (DAC) technology that leverages the natural chemistry of abundant limestone to absorb CO2, separate the carbon, and store it underground as mineral lime. Its approach includes proprietary technology across the kiln, lime preparation, and air contactor, and the system is fuel flexible to adapt to changing energy mixes. The company aims to scale its process to deliver carbon removal at commercial scale and plans further research at its technology and research centre in Bristol. Origen is advancing projects worldwide, including work on the ground in Louisiana and a facility under construction in North Dakota. It has announced a partnership with the Energy and Environmental Research Center (EERC) to capture 1,000 tonnes per annum and is developing the Pelican Gulf Coast project (with Shell and Mitsubishi) expected to remove up to 50,000 tonnes per year. Origen recently secured funding to support scaling and commercialization, including a Series A announced in January 2025.
